#14349d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#14349d is composed of 7.8% red, 20.4%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.3% cyan, 66.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 226 degrees, a saturation of 77.4% and a lightness of 34.7%. #14349d color hex could be obtained by blending #2868ff with #00003b.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

#14349d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#14349d has RGB values of R:20, G:52, B:157 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0.67,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 1324189.
